14 references to FastPathTokenizer
Microsoft.AspNetCore.Routing (1)
Matching\DfaMatcher.cs (1)
46
var count =
FastPathTokenizer
.Tokenize(path, buffer);
Microsoft.AspNetCore.Routing.Microbenchmarks (4)
Matching\FastPathTokenizerEmptyBenchmark.cs (1)
29
FastPathTokenizer
.Tokenize(path, segments);
Matching\FastPathTokenizerLargeBenchmark.cs (1)
33
FastPathTokenizer
.Tokenize(path, segments);
Matching\FastPathTokenizerPlaintextBenchmark.cs (1)
29
FastPathTokenizer
.Tokenize(path, segments);
Matching\FastPathTokenizerSmallBenchmark.cs (1)
29
FastPathTokenizer
.Tokenize(path, segments);
Microsoft.AspNetCore.Routing.Tests (9)
Matching\DfaMatcherTest.cs (1)
571
var count =
FastPathTokenizer
.Tokenize(requestPath, buffer);
Matching\FastPathTokenizerTest.cs (8)
17
var count =
FastPathTokenizer
.Tokenize("", segments);
30
var count =
FastPathTokenizer
.Tokenize("/", segments);
43
var count =
FastPathTokenizer
.Tokenize("/abc", segments);
57
var count =
FastPathTokenizer
.Tokenize("/a/b/c", segments);
73
var count =
FastPathTokenizer
.Tokenize("/a/b/c/", segments);
89
var count =
FastPathTokenizer
.Tokenize("/aaa/bb/ccccc", segments);
105
var count =
FastPathTokenizer
.Tokenize("///c", segments);
121
var count =
FastPathTokenizer
.Tokenize("/a/b/c/d", segments);